How many moles of carbon dioxide are in 22 grams?

Convert 22 g of carbon dioxide (CO_(2)) into moles. (Atomic masses : C = 12 u, O = 16 u) So, the mass of 1 mole of carbon dioxide is 44 grams. Thus, 22 grams of carbon dioxide are equal to 0.5 mole.
